We’re looking for a collections assistant to assist the National Videogame Museum in completing museum accreditation process, to support development of a more accessible collection, and to deliver a cataloguing project.
Contract: Fixed term for 12 months
Hours: Full-time (40 hours / 5 days a week, flexible)
Salary: £20,000
Accountabilities:
- Assist the museum accreditation process by completing and delivering the Managing Collections section.
- Design and deliver a cataloguing project
- Support the development of a more accessible Collection.
Accreditation process:
- Review and develop the NVM’s Collections policy within the guidelines of the
accreditation process - Submit policy and incorporate feedback from stakeholders
- Finalise the Collections policy section in the Accreditation submission
Cataloguing project:
- Identify key elements of the Collection
- Design a cataloguing project for a subset of objects in the Collection
- Deliver the cataloguing project, documenting, cataloguing, researching and labelling
objects using our collections management system
Accessibility of the Collection:
- Assist with the management and care of the Collection, including handling, packing
and storage of objects - Develop interpretation plans for elements of the Collection with curatorial staff
- Devise ways to Improve the general accessibility of the Collection for both the public
and researchers - Use Beacon, our Customer Relationship Management system, to understand visitor
engagement with collections including object handling sessions and object offers - Handle and track Collections enquiries including loans
